Garmin Cirqa Is Here: 10 Top Facts About Garmin’s Screen-Free Tracker

The $199.99 band tracks sleep, recovery and activity without a display or required subscription, Garmin said.

  • On Tuesday, July 21, 2026, Garmin announced the Cirqa Smart Band, a $199.99 screen-free fitness tracker available to order July 24. The device tracks sleep, recovery, and fitness metrics without requiring a daily charge or subscription.
  • Designed to provide health data without daily charging or constant notifications, the Cirqa offers an alternative to full-screen wearables like the Apple Watch. Its "Fiber reinforced polymer" casing prioritizes low weight over design complexity.
  • The tracker features 10-day battery life and weighs 14.8g, with 5ATM water resistance for showering and swimming. It supports Connected GPS for accurate running metrics and broadcasts heart rate data to compatible devices.
  • Unlike competitors such as Whoop, the Cirqa requires no ongoing subscription; all features unlock with the $199.99 purchase. The device auto-tracks "running and walking" and integrates with the Garmin Connect app and Natural Cycles platform for women's health insights.
  • This entry into the screen-free wearable category positions Garmin against established rivals like Whoop and Oura, reflecting growing consumer demand for unobtrusive health tracking. The Cirqa's July 24 order date signals Garmin's strategic expansion into a market increasingly popular among users seeking data without distraction.

Garmin announced on the 22nd that it is launching the ‘Circa Smartband,’ a smartband that eliminates the display to focus on wearing and recording functions. This marks the first time Garmin has released a screenless wearable device. The Circa Smartband automatically recognizes and records daily activities, such as exercise and sleep, without the user having to check a screen or operate it frequently.
